Quoting: scaineI love how ridiculously divisive we all are as Linux users. :grin:Its fine if you like it.
Dare I ask... why the hate for flatpak (a puke emoji, no less!)? If I can't install something directly, I want a flatpak. I'll use an AppImage and resent it, because it (often) doesn't create a menu item, it requires me to find a place for it to live (I usually bung them in ~/Misc/Apps or something), and doesn't update with the rest of my system. I won't use snap, as I'm not interested in YAI (yet another installer) when I already have flatpak.
flatpaks are just awful with their runtimes and permissions. Appimage at least is fully self-contained sandbox, not some random runtime this and that here and there with sometimes no access to this or that unless you manually modify things.
each their own. I don't like my distro to become an android device.
native distro packages are prefered for me.
